Mark Morrison - A Glimpse into His Life
Mark Anthony Joseph Morrison, a British singer, came into the world on May 3, 1974. He's most widely recognized for his 1996 platinum-selling song, "Return of the Mack," which, you know, quickly found a lot of success. His singing career actually started a few years before that, back in 1993, and by 1995, he had put out his first single, called "Crazy." This initial work set the stage for what would become his truly massive hit. How Did "Return of the Mack" Become Such a Big Deal?
On April 22, 1996, a performer who was, you know, not widely known at the time, Mark Morrison, put out his first record, also titled "Return of the Mack." The main song from that record would go on to be one of the biggest musical pieces of the 1990s, reaching the top positions on music popularity lists in the United Kingdom and other parts of Europe, as well as Australia. This particular song, a creation of the British R&B singer, was put out in 1996 as the third single from his first record. It just really seemed to connect with people.
The song's breakthrough moment came when it hit the top ten around the globe in 1996, and then, in a way, it opened up the American music market for him the very next year. A fun fact about the song is that it used a piece of music from "Genius of Love" by Tom Tom Club, which, you know, adds another layer to its sound. Mark Morrison himself spoke about writing the song, noting in a book that when he created it, he wanted it to be an uplifting club track. It actually became a huge success in the summer of 1997, showing its wide appeal and how it could get people moving. The song's artwork for the debut album was, in fact, quite attention-grabbing, showing handcuffs in a way that seemed to challenge viewers, fitting the artist's reputation as a "bad boy."

The Challenges and Controversies Surrounding Mark Morrison
The journey of Mark Morrison has, quite honestly, included some difficulties and public issues. His past has been described as having some rough patches, and his career has seen its share of legal troubles. For instance, he was taken into custody in Florida on accusations of physical assault. Specifically, the singer of "Return of the Mack" was accused of a minor physical offense after he, you know, pushed a person twice at a place called Le Bar à Vin in Palm Beach. This particular event was reportedly set off by a disagreement about music the night before. Calling Mark Morrison a "bad boy" is, in some respects, almost an understatement, reflecting a reputation that has, perhaps, followed him.
These legal matters are part of his public story, alongside his musical achievements. His biography on Genius mentions his legal issues, providing a bit more detail about these parts of his life.
